whenReady().then(() => {

createWindow()

app.on(‘activate’, () => {

if (BrowserWindow.getAllWindows().length === 0) {

createWindow()

}

})

})

app.on(‘window-all-closed’, () => {

if (process.platform !== ‘darwin’) {

app.quit()

}

})

“`

在上面的代碼中,創建了一個名為“createWindow”的函數,該函數創建了一個新的瀏覽器窗口,并加載了“index.html”文件。在“app.whenReady()”函數中,調用了“createWindow”函數來創建一個瀏覽器窗口。在“app.on(‘activate’)”函數中,當所有窗口都關閉時,再次調用“createWindow”函數來創建一個新的瀏覽器窗口。

5. 打包Electron應用程序

最后,需要將Electron應用程序打包成可執行文件。可以使用Electron提供的打包工具來打包應用程序。在命令行中輸入以下命令:

“`

npx electron-forge make

“`

這將創建一個可執行文件,可以在Windows、macOS和Linux上運行。

總結

將HTML5應用程序轉換為本地應用程序需要使用Electron框架。使用Electron,可以輕松地將現有的Web應用程序轉換為本地應用程序,并在多種操作系統上運行。Electron提供了許多工具和API,可以幫助開發人員構建跨平臺的應用程序。

未經允許不得轉載:亦門 » html5生成exe是怎么實現的?

相關推薦